In Department of Transportation v. Association of American Railroads, the U.S. Supreme Court held that Amtrak is more like a public entity than a private entity but remanded the case back to the lower court to consider questions about how Amtrak's board is appointed and whether there are due process concerns with giving Amtrak regulatory authority over its own industry.
